    A little project I put together this week. Travel humidor thats durable & roomy enough that I can bring enough to share with friends, or I can bring some variety. Since it's see-thru, I can keep an eye on contents and humidity/temp without cracking it open.

    It's a little short for longer cigars but I like the robust band size, and it holds 9 robust sized perfectly, with a cutter, lighter, digital hygrometer, and humidifier element. There are 4 compartments. The divider is floating. Originally this plastic tube was a pencil/pen holder, according to the label.

    Tube is 6" high by 4" diameter.
